JUSTICE MIHIR KUMAR JHA ORAL ORDER 04-02-2015 Heard learned counsel for the parties.
Having regard to the nature of allegation against the petitioners for offence under sections 25(1-B)A, 26(2) and 25 of the Arms Act and the fact that both the petitioners have got no criminal antecedent, this Court keeping in view the recovery of a unlicensed pistol each from both the petitioners, would direct for release of the petitioners, namely, Rahul Kumar Singh and
Patna High Court Cr.Misc. No.43704 of 2014 (3) dt.04-02-2015 Abhishek Kumar @ Abhishek Singh, on bail on or after 17th February, 2015 when they would complete judicial custody of a period of six months on furnishing bail bond of Rs.10,000/- (ten thousand) each with two sureties of the like amount each to the satisfaction of the Chief Judicial Magistrate, Saran (Chapra) in Chapra Muffasil P.S.Case No. 175/2014, subject to the following conditions:
(i) That both the bailors will be a close relative of the petitioners who will give an affidavit giving genealogy as to how they are related with the petitioners. The bailors will also undertake to inform the Court if there is any change in the address of the petitioners.
(ii) That the bailor shall also state on affidavit that they will inform the Court concerned if the petitioners are implicated in any other case of similar nature after their release in the present case and thereafter the Court below will be at liberty to initiate the proceeding for cancellation of bail on the ground of misuse.
(iii) That the petitioners will give an undertaking that they will receive the police papers on the given date and be present on the date fixed for charge and if they fail to do so on two given dates and delay the trial in any manner,
Patna High Court Cr.Misc. No.43704 of 2014 (3) dt.04-02-2015 their bail will be liable to be cancelled for reasons of misuse.
(iv) That the petitioners will be well represented on each and every date of trial and if they fail to do so on two consecutive dates, their bail will be liable to be cancelled on this ground alone.
